Sympathy Card

This card uses Heartfelt Creations flower stamps and dies and Stamping Up sentiment.  The frame die is from Our Daily Bread.  I used Lavender and Lime Brilliance inks.  The center of the flowers are prills from Heartfelt Creations.

Colored Pencils on Kraft

So there is a current tutorial on coloring with colored pencils on Kraft paper and I wanted to try again.  I did this a few years ago but honestly I just don't practice enough to be good at it.  I watched two different videos and gave it a try and the results are ok, not as nice as the gals in the videos!  I think one of the problems is I don't have a big collection of colors.  I have 36 Prismacolors but not three shades of each colors and it doesn't match right.  I only have one gray and it is too blue...well anyway we will see if I remedy that situation!  I do love the look on Kraft!  This card isn't done,  I don't have any Valentines Day stamp expressions to finish it yet.  Just felt like posting it!



UPDATE:  Here is the finished card, I so liked the image to be the focal point I didn't add too much.

More Yeti Cuteness!


I am having so much fun with this My Favorite Things Beast Friends set!  It took a while to make this card and my friend who is not a card maker couldn't understand why this takes several hours.  Well here ya go, stamping, coloring, die cutting, more die cutting, more die cutting... but that's what I love.  The dies here are the card pop up box, the rectangles to go on the box, snow drifts, tree line, layered snowflakes and the yeti's.  I posted a couple pictures of my workspace as I got the various  parts prepared.  Hopefully she understands now - hard to explain otherwise!  I will be making more of this, already started on a pink one.  I am so pleased with how this turned out, too cute again!
